Altenar Scores Big: Named Sportsbook Supplier of the Year at SBC Americas Awards 2026

Altenar just landed a major win in the betting world, being crowned “Sportsbook Supplier of the Year” at the SBC Americas Awards 2026 in Fort Lauderdale, Florida. The event brought together the biggest names in betting and gaming from across North America, Latin America, and the Caribbean, celebrating those pushing the industry forward with innovation and reliability.

This award marks another high point for Altenar, which has been gaining serious momentum throughout the Americas. Known for its flexible, high-performance sportsbook technology, the company has become a go-to partner for operators in both established and newly regulated markets.

The recognition comes right after Altenar secured approval from Alberta Gaming, Liquor and Cannabis Commission (AGLC), opening the door to providing sportsbook solutions in Alberta just as the province prepares to roll out its regulated online gaming market. It’s another move that strengthens Altenar’s foothold in the region’s booming sports betting space.

Charlie Williams, Altenar’s Commercial Director, called the award “a tremendous achievement” for the entire team. He emphasized how important the American markets have become for Altenar’s growth strategy, noting that operators are increasingly seeking tech partners who understand their local needs — whether that’s handling compliance rules, tailoring products to audiences, or providing smooth, reliable performance.
